Nick Watney – Age 39
In some countries, golf is one of the few sports that has been deemed safe to play during the COVID-19 pandemic. This is due to it meeting social distancing protocol since players are not in physical contact and can maintain distance easily. So it was a bit of a shock when golfer Nick Watney became the first PGA golfer to test positive.
Watney actually tested negative a few days before. But after noticing that his Whoop Band was picking up elevated breathing patterns, he decided to test again, which confirmed his suspicions. The test result meant he had to pull out o the RBC Heritage tournament.
